## Signing — Relevance Notes Bundle

Plugin authors consuming the Findory relevance tuning notes must verify the bundle signature before applying weights. Unverified bundles are rejected by the plugin host. Bundles are published weekly and signed automatically. Verify each download against the key provided below.

release key, hadug-kawef: bky13_mPGeFZeR1GZ1G

## Telemetry Compression Across Environments

The Quillbark ingestion service compresses telemetry payloads before they leave each edge node. In staging we use a lighter compression level to keep CPU headroom for test runs, while production favors maximum ratio because bandwidth between the Tanwick and Holloway sites is metered. Please do not change the codec without sign-off from the platform lead. The production values currently in effect are listed below.

config for kafof-bawef:
holath:
  log_level: debug
  metrics_host: metrics.holath.qorvelsys.internal
  pin: 2191
  pool_size: 32

Action item from the Fennick outage: the orphaned-resource sweeper deleted volumes still referenced by paused jobs because the grace window was shorter than the pause TTL. Fix shipped; sweeper now checks pause state explicitly. Maintainers: do not shorten the grace window below the pause TTL again, ever. The relationship between these constants is load-bearing. Current production values are recorded here for reference.

tuning constants:
TIERS = {
    "sorion": 670,
    "istax": 547,
}